Inspection on 12/11/2024

High Priority
3
Intermediate
3
Basic
4
Total
10
Disposition: Follow-up Inspection Required

Inspection Details:

  • 22-20-5:Basic - Accumulation of black/green mold-like substance in the interior of the ice machine/bin. Interior of ice bin soiled.
  • 14-01-5:Basic - Bowl or other container with no handle used to dispense food. Cup without handle used to dispense salt. Operator removed cup. Corrected On-Site Repeat Violation
  • 14-11-5:Basic - Equipment in poor repair. Gasket on reach in freezer near kitchen entry door and gasket on walk-in-cooler torn. Also, handle on microwave on cook line missing.
  • 36-17-5:Basic - Floor tiles missing and/or in disrepair. Multiple floor tiles in kitchen chipped/ in disrepair.
  • 08A-05-6:High Priority - Raw animal food stored over/not properly separated from ready-to-eat food. Raw fish stored over ready to eat tortillas in reach in freezer next to fryer. Operator removed raw fish to properly store. Also, raw chicken stored over raw pork in reach-in cooler on cook line. Operator removed raw chicken to properly store. Corrected On-Site
  • 03A-02-5:High Priority - Time/temperature control for safety food cold held at greater than 41 degrees Fahrenheit. milk (45F - Cold Holding) in reach in cooler at front service line. Employee stated she had it out to make beverages earlier. Operator stated he will keep milk in cooler to chill. Also, flan (49F - Cold Holding) in deli case in dining area. Operator noticed top door of deli case not fully closed. Operator readjusted door and stated he will keep door closed to chill flan. **Corrective Action Taken** Repeat Violation Admin Complaint
  • 41-10-4:High Priority - Toxic substance/chemical improperly stored. Two containers of toxic substance stored next to salt and flour on shelf across from grill area. Operator removed glean and cleaner to properly store. Corrected On-Site
  • 02C-03-5:Intermediate - Commercially processed ready-to-eat, time/temperature control for safety food opened and held more than 24 hours not properly date marked after opening. Container of milk opened Sunday not date marked. Operator date marked milk. Corrected On-Site Repeat Violation
  • 22-02-4:Intermediate - Food-contact surface soiled with food debris, mold-like substance or slime. Wedger on prep shelf above triple sink has accumulation of food debris.
  • 53B-01-5:Intermediate - No proof of required state approved employee training provided for any employees. To order approved program food safety material, call DBPR contracted provider: Florida Restaurant and Lodging Association (SafeStaff) 866-372-7233. Operator Mable to provide proof of employee food safety training. Warning

Inspection on 3/6/2024

High Priority
1
Intermediate
1
Basic
3
Total
5
Disposition: Met Inspection Standards

Inspection Details:

  • 14-01-5:Basic - Bowl or other container with no handle used to dispense food. Cup without handle used to dispense beans on cookline in reach-in cooler across from grill area. Operator removed souflee cup from beans. Corrected On-Site
  • 08B-39-4:Basic - Raw fruits/vegetables not washed prior to preparation. Cut avocado on cookline not washed prior to being cut. Sticker still adhered to avocado.
  • 21-07-4:Basic - Wiping cloth chlorine sanitizing solution not at proper minimum strength. Sanitizer Bucket (Chlorine 0ppm) on cookline. Operator added bleach to water and retested at 100ppm Corrected On-Site
  • 03A-02-5:High Priority - Time/temperature control for safety food cold held at greater than 41 degrees Fahrenheit. tres leche cake (46F - Cold Holding)in front dessert display case. Operator stated the temperature was raised because other items in case got hard. Operator moving tres leche to a nearby cooler to chill. Also, sliced American cheese (45F - Cold Holding) in walk-in-cooler..Operator stated the walk-in-cooler door was opened and closed a lot this morning. Operator stated he will keep door closed for cheese to chill. **Corrective Action Taken**
  • 02C-03-5:Intermediate - Commercially processed ready-to-eat, time/temperature control for safety food opened and held more than 24 hours not properly date marked after opening. Commercially packed hotdogs opened more than 24 hours not date marked. Operator date marked package of hot dogs. Corrected On-Site
